Hotel Miraflores Lodge
Search & compare prices for Hotel Miraflores Lodge in all hotel booking websites.
Hotel Miraflores Lodge Address: Calle Colon 230, Lima, Peru
Minimum price found for Hotel Miraflores Lodge was: Null PEN
Click here to get more information, photos & guest ratings for Hotel Miraflores Lodge